GE LightSpeed CT750 HD The GE LightSpeed CT750 HD Computed Tomography X-ray system is intended to produce cross-sectional images of the body by computer reconstruction of x-ray transmission data taken at different angles and planes, including Axial, Cine, Helical (Volumetric), Cardiac, Spectral, and Gated acquisitions for all ages.

Hazard

GE Healthcare conducted a recall involving 2 events affecting the GE LightSpeed CT750 HD. Event 1 - There was a report regarding CT number variance in time line at posterior fossa region of head perfusion.
